Pumpkin Oreo Balls are a delightful no-bake treat that captures the essence of autumn in every bite. Combining creamy pumpkin puree, crushed Oreo cookies, and rich cream cheese, these indulgent bites are coated in smooth white chocolate, making them perfect for Halloween parties or Thanksgiving celebrations. Ingredients
Scale
- 1 package (15.35 oz) Oreo Cookies
- 1 cup canned pumpkin puree
- 8 oz cream cheese, softened
- 1 cup white chocolate chips
- 1 tsp ground cinnamon
Instructions
- Crush the Oreo cookies into fine crumbs using a food processor or by smashing them in a zip-top bag.
- In a mixing bowl, combine crushed Oreos, pumpkin puree, cream cheese, and cinnamon until smooth.
- Scoop out tablespoon-sized portions of the mixture and roll into balls. Place on a parchment-lined baking sheet.
- Chill the balls in the refrigerator for 30 minutes to firm up.
- Melt white chocolate chips in a microwave-safe bowl until smooth.
- Dip each chilled ball into melted chocolate, coating completely. Return to parchment paper to set.
